Web20 sep. 2016 · There are three basic types of marine insurance: Hull and Machinery, Cargo, and Protection & Indemnity (P&I) insurance. This article is an overview of P&I and coverage concerns related to it. What is P&I? P&I insurance is liability coverage for vessel owners. WebMarine insurance. Web5. Cargo stowage and securing A list can cause cargo to break loose if it is not correctly stowed and secured. The problem is made worse because the crew of the ship cannot normally see how the cargo is stowed inside or on the trailer in which it is transported. A heavy load which breaks loose can cause other units to follow suit. healthcare managed it servicesWeb25 nov. 2016 · Here are the top 10 steps to ensure your ship can escape a pirate attack.. 1.
